while($x)

Community per sviluppatori Italiani


Cos'è

while($x) è una community italiana opensource per developer.

Funzionamento

Lo sviluppo è gestito in micro-progetti legati da un unico "core" che permette l'accesso ad un database unificato e alle diverse api interne/esterne. Ogni progetto è proposto tramite mailing list e ottiene l'approvazione alla sua realizzazione quando un minimo di 3 developer si prendono la responsabilità di svilupparlo e mantenerlo.

Obiettivo

L'obiettivo è di lavorare insieme, imparare dal codice degli altri e sviluppare insieme un intero portale dedicato a programmatori italiani chiamato while($x) senza badare a date di scadenza e se ci sono problemi di progettazione sarà compito di tutti risolverli consultandoci tramite mailing list. Ogni micro-progetto deve essere proposto al fine di raggiungere questi obiettivi.

Come Contribuire

Il portale è interamente sviluppato su GitHub e chiunque potrà forkarlo e modificarlo per contribuire!
La documentazione è fornita tramite i file README di ogni repository e i commenti nel codice.
Puoi proporre tramite mailing list un nuovo repository dedicato ad un nuovo progetto, questo verrà creato raggiunti 3 developer interessati a lavorarci insieme a te. Tutti i developer si occupano dei "whilex_core" che comprende una classi php che si occupano di:
• Accesso al database mysql con allegato dump.sql
• Dati condivisi (ad esempio registrazione utente e login)
• Classi di sicurezza in php

Per lavorare con noi nello sviluppo di whilex.it devi iscriverti alla mailing list.
La mailing list è l'unica forma ufficiale di comunicazione con i developer della piattaforma.
Per iscriverti scrivi a whilex-subscribe@ptkweb.it un messaggio vuoto che ti guiderà passo-passo.
Dopo l'iscrizione potrai contattare tutti i membri scrivendo a whilex@ptkweb.it.

LIMITAZIONI PER LO SVILUPPO:
• È vietato l'uso di cms wordpress/joomla e framework come cakephp/code igniter/laravel.
• Codice commentato e README su github completo di istruzioni per l'uso e installazione
• L'uso di classi php di altri progetti o di framework di supporto come jquery è consentito.

GPL

Il portale e i suoi progetti sono coperti dalla licenza AGPLv3 / GPLv3